In March 2001, the University implemented the Zip + 4 Numbering System to improve mail services and provide a more effective and efficient way to process mail for our UNCW community. All departments will share our main zip code 28403, but the plus-4 is a specific and unique four-digit number assigned to each department. The plus-4 will accompany the address on all envelopes, letterhead, business cards, incoming mail and inter-campus correspondence identifying that specific department. This eliminates confusing abbreviations and improves speed and accuracy in sorting. Encourage your correspondents to send their replies to your full address. Building and room numbers should not be used in campus addresses.
The following formats are outlined for your guidance when addressing U.S. Mail and intra-campus mail:
For automation purposes, the US Postal Service prefers black ink, block form addresses with a uniform left-hand margin, and no punctuation except for the dash between the zip code and the plus 4.
